Picture Notes: More Information: Distribution: Meconopsis betonicifolia x Meconopsis grandis. Synonyms: Hardiness Zone: USDA Zones 6 (view USDA zone map) Size: 4 ft. Form: Herbaceous perennial. Bark: Stem/Bud: Leaves: Leaves alternate, basal and lower leaves oblong lanceolate, serrate, to 8 in. long, bristly. Upper leaves sessile. Fall Color: Flower: Flowers blue with 4 petals, on stalks in the upper leaf axils. Fruit: Fruit are capsules which open from the top downward..
